Under the General's Nose: Who is Hunting Our Soldiers?

A post popped up on my Facebook feed featuring a soldier. The author, in English of course, stated the soldier's full name and added: "L. is an IDF commander in the Jordan Valley and has been documented committing war crimes against civilians. Make her famous." The post was accompanied by clear photos of the soldier. In one, she is smiling with friends, her face clearly visible; in another, she covers part of her face, realizing who she is dealing with.

The person who uploaded the photos and details of the soldier is Andrei Kharzhevsky, a prominent anti-Israel activist. With hundreds of thousands of followers on social media, he wanders throughout Judea and Samaria and also within Israel proper, and does not shy away from any means. He creates provocations against residents and farmers, harasses soldiers, taunts them, violates orders, vandalizes a memorial for a fallen soldier from October 7, taunts soldiers at the Gaza border, and more.

Kharzhevsky immigrated to Israel from Russia in 2022. He fled from there because "it was the passport that was easiest for me to obtain" (according to him, in an interview with the Haaretz newspaper) — and he has been here ever since. He received asylum in the Jewish state, which grants safe haven to anyone eligible under the Law of Return — and Andrei is eligible. Andrei speaks only English because he is not addressing the Israeli public at all, which does not interest him. "I left that society. I live in the West Bank and socialize with Palestinians. I don't think I would define myself as an Israeli," he says. And what about returning to Russia? "I am afraid to return to Russia and sit in prison for 20 years... If you return to Russia, you have to be silent, and I am not capable of being silent." And so, he spits in the well that watered him, a privilege of Jews, and stabs a knife in the back of the country that granted him safe haven.

Last week, when the entire country was busy with the complex and shameful incident in Qusra, Andrei was one of the provocateurs on the ground and acted against the soldiers. In one of the documented cases, he tried to infiltrate a closed military zone in an ambulance, using methods reminiscent of Hamas tactics, while sitting in the front seat and documenting the soldiers. Since then, Andrei has managed to upload another post with photos of soldiers from another area in Judea and Samaria. There, too, he asked his hundreds of thousands of followers to identify the soldiers and "make them famous."

The responses to his posts are full of antisemitism and hatred. His followers tag the International Court of Justice in The Hague, the Hind Rajab Foundation (an organization that pursues IDF soldiers around the world), various UN organizations, and more. All this is accompanied by antisemitic cartoons and engineered images of "Israel's war crimes." The soldiers are completely exposed to a well-oiled and sophisticated propaganda machine, which includes not only Andrei, but organizations and massive international money intended to pursue Israel and the soldiers personally.

Andrei is not alone. Daria Yurova, a friend of Andrei's, who goes by the online handle "Adele Choco," walks around Judea and Samaria with a "PRESS" vest and confronts security forces, while filming everything and uploading it to the networks. By the way, this same Daria Yurova also wants to receive Israeli citizenship, and she is currently waiting for approval from the Population and Immigration Authority. God forbid we have an "Andrei 2" case here. Joining them are radical Israeli activists, some from the organization "Looking the Occupation in the Eye," who also engage in mass shaming of soldiers and commanders on the ground.

Has anyone knocked on the door of these anti-Israel activists and demanded answers? Has anyone distanced them from the field? Has a restraining order been issued against them from Judea, Samaria, and the Jordan Valley? Nothing. Everything is happening under the nose of the regional commander, the Chief of Staff, and the Minister of Defense. The soldiers are abandoned to the deadly jaws of the anti-Israel machine — and the State of Israel is not backing them up.
